Directions

I start by placing the chicken in the bottom of the slow cooker. I add the diced onion, garlic, corn, potatoes, and seasonings on top.

I pour in the chicken broth, making sure everything is mostly covered. I cover and cook on low until the chicken is tender and the potatoes are soft.

Once cooked, I remove the chicken, shred it, and return it to the slow cooker. I stir in the cream cheese, heavy cream, and milk, letting everything warm through until smooth and creamy.

I taste and adjust the seasoning as needed, then finish with fresh herbs before serving.

Servings and Timing

I usually get about 6 servings from this soup.
Prep time: 10 minutes
Cook time: 6–7 hours on low or 3–4 hours on high
Total time: about 6–7 hours

Variations

I sometimes add carrots or celery for extra vegetables. When I want more depth of flavor, I sauté the onion and garlic before adding them to the slow cooker. I also like adding shredded cheese for an even richer soup.

Storage/Reheating

I store leftovers in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to 4 days. When reheating, I warm it gently on the stovetop or in the microwave, stirring well to keep the soup creamy. Slow Cooker Creamy Chicken & Corn Soup

FAQs

Can I use rotisserie chicken?

I can, and I usually add it during the last hour just to heat through.

Can I freeze this soup?

I can freeze it, but I find the texture is best when enjoyed fresh or refrigerated.

How do I make the soup thicker?

I mash some of the potatoes directly in the slow cooker or let the soup simmer uncovered for a bit.

Can I make this soup dairy-free?

I can substitute dairy-free cream alternatives and skip the cream cheese.

What can I serve with this soup?

I like serving it with crusty bread, biscuits, or a simple side salad.
